According to local media reports, the European Commission has approved a 1.1 billion euro (about 8.824 billion yuan ) French state aid plan to support strategic investment in line with the objectives of the Clean Industry Agreement. In order to increase the capacity of clean technology manufacturing, this will also contribute to the realization of the EU's goal of net zero emission economic transformation.
The plan was approved in accordance with the National Assistance Framework for Clean Industries adopted by the European Commission in June 2025. The latest French aid plan is the eighth clean technology capacity assistance project approved under the framework. At present, the total amount of support for the framework has exceeded 10 billion euros (about 80.214 billion yuan ).
The plan encourages investment in more zero-emission production capacity, including equipment manufacturing for solar, onshore and offshore wind power plants, heat pumps and energy storage systems . The plan also covers business expenditures related to the purchase of key components and important raw materials for these technologies. The subsidy will be in the form of a tax credit , valid until the end of 2028 and applicable throughout France.
